linux服务器计算节点选择命令
-
选择Linux服务器计算节点的命令有多种,具体取决于你的需求和环境。以下是一些常见的命令:
1. top:显示当前系统中运行的进程和资源使用情况。可以通过按下”1″键来查看每个CPU的负载。这个命令可以帮助你快速了解服务器上的计算节点的使用情况。
2. ps:显示当前运行的进程信息。可以使用一些选项来筛选特定的进程,比如使用“ps aux | grep [进程名]”来查找特定进程。
3. htop:类似于top命令,但提供了更多的功能和可视化界面。可以使用此命令来监视和管理计算节点上的进程。
4. lscpu:显示有关CPU的详细信息,包括型号、速度、核心数等。这个命令可以帮助你了解服务器上可用的计算资源。
5. lshw:显示计算机硬件信息,包括CPU、内存、硬盘、网卡等。通过这个命令可以查看计算节点上的硬件配置。
6. sar:系统活动报告工具,可以帮助你监视和记录系统的性能指标,比如CPU利用率、内存使用情况、I/O操作等。
7. mpstat:显示有关多处理器系统的统计信息,包括每个CPU的利用率、上下文切换、进程数量等。
这些命令可以帮助你选择和管理Linux服务器上的计算节点。根据你的需求,选择合适的命令来监视和优化计算节点的性能。
2年前 -
在选择适合的计算节点时,可以使用以下命令来帮助确定:
1. `lscpu`:此命令将显示计算节点的CPU信息,包括厂商、型号、核心数、线程数等。可以使用此命令来获取计算节点的处理能力和多线程支持情况。
2. `cat /proc/meminfo`:此命令将显示计算节点的内存信息,包括总内存、可用内存、缓存等。可以使用此命令来了解计算节点的内存容量和使用情况。
3. `df -h`:此命令将显示计算节点的磁盘使用情况,包括每个挂载点的使用情况和可用空间。可以使用此命令来判断计算节点的磁盘容量是否满足需求。
4. `nproc`:此命令将显示计算节点的CPU核心数。可以使用此命令来确定计算节点的并行计算能力。
5. `free -m`:此命令将以MB为单位显示计算节点的内存使用情况,包括总内存、已用内存、可用内存等。可以使用此命令来评估计算节点的内存使用情况。
以上命令可以帮助您了解计算节点的硬件情况和使用情况,从而选择适合的计算节点来部署您的应用程序。
2年前 -
在Linux服务器上选择计算节点的命令可以根据实际需求来选择不同的命令进行操作。以下是一些常用的命令和操作流程。
1. 查看系统信息
使用以下命令可以查看服务器的系统信息,包括处理器架构、内存大小等。
“`shell
$ uname -a
$ cat /proc/cpuinfo
$ cat /proc/meminfo
“`2. 查看节点负载
使用以下命令可以查看节点的负载情况,包括CPU利用率、内存利用率等。
“`shell
$ top
$ uptime
$ sar -u
$ sar -r
“`3. 查看进程
使用以下命令可以查看系统中正在运行的进程信息。
“`shell
$ ps -ef | grep node
$ top
“`4. 远程连接节点
使用以下命令可以通过SSH远程连接到计算节点。
“`shell
$ ssh username@ipaddress
“`5. 集群管理工具
如果有使用集群管理工具来管理计算节点,可以使用相应的命令来查看和管理节点。
例如,如果使用Slurm集群管理器,可以使用以下命令来查看节点状态。
“`shell
$ sinfo
$ scontrol show node
“`6. 调度作业
如果需要在计算节点上运行任务,可以使用Job调度器来分配任务到节点上。
例如,如果使用Slurm集群管理器,可以使用以下命令提交作业。
“`shell
$ sbatch script.sh
“`7. 监视节点性能
使用以下命令可以监视节点的性能情况,包括CPU利用率、内存利用率等。
“`shell
$ top
$ sar -u
$ sar -r
“`总结:以上是一些常用的在Linux服务器上选择计算节点的命令和操作流程。可以通过查看系统信息、节点负载、进程等来选择合适的计算节点,并使用集群管理工具来管理和调度节点。同时,还可以使用监视节点性能的命令来了解节点的性能情况。
2年前